Red Mountain Middle School
Red Mountain Middle School serves 833 students in grades 7-8.
Red Mountain Middle School placed in the bottom 50% of all schools in New Mexico for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%) for the 2018-19 school year.
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 21% (which is equal to the New Mexico state average of 21%) for the 2018-19 school year. The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 24% (which is lower than the New Mexico state average of 33%) for the 2018-19 school year.
The student:teacher ratio of 15:1 is higher than the New Mexico state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 89%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the New Mexico state average of 79% (majority Hispanic).
